Output f2789c8fdcff91d834f785bcee722b08017cc73b9401efc0f93f29564d6930aa:2

value
128035268
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ca576e871a1944de1cfa7d88e97f54a714c54dc OP_EQUALVERIFY OP_CHECKSIG
address
17zGaFgCc1gkHTUDSuugj21qHokqQtFtvs
transaction
f2789c8fdcff91d834f785bcee722b08017cc73b9401efc0f93f29564d6930aa
confirmations
459695
spent
true